Comparing FDM to resin? The Anycubic Kobra 2 Max ($399, FDM) and Phrozen Sonic Mini 8K S ($329, RESIN) use fundamentally different technologies. FDM melts filament layer by layer; resin cures liquid with UV light. Here's how they stack up.

Specifications
| Spec | Anycubic Kobra 2 Max | Phrozen Sonic Mini 8K S |
|---|---|---|
| Price | $399 | $329 |
| Type | FDM | RESIN |
| Build Volume | 420 x 420 x 500 mm | 165 x 72 x 180 mm |
| Print Speed | 500 mm/s | 80 mm/s |
| Min Resolution | 0.05 mm | 0.01 mm |
| Weight | 20.5 kg | 6.5 kg |

Pros & Cons
Anycubic Kobra 2 Max
+420x420x500mm for $399 is the largest bed you'll find at this budget
+Direct drive at this scale handles flexible filament when needed
+WiFi means you're not walking over with a USB stick for every job
−Open frame on a 420mm heated bed means serious adhesion prep is mandatory
−Full bed heating at this size takes 10+ minutes to reach temp
−Discontinued: Anycubic no longer supports this model
Phrozen Sonic Mini 8K S
+22-micron XY resolution: individual scales on dragon miniatures, every rivet on armor, no blurring
+ParaLED 3.0 delivers even exposure across the full plate, no hot spots
+Mono LCD longevity is proven at 2,000+ hours without degradation
+Phrozen's resin profiles are dialed in out of the box
−80mm/hr print speed is the slowest on this list: patience required
−165x72mm plate is tiny; large models need slicing and gluing
−No WiFi: USB drive and manual file management only
−Phrozen's recommended resin is pricier than generic alternatives

What's the main difference between Anycubic Kobra 2 Max and Phrozen Sonic Mini 8K S?
Technology: the Anycubic Kobra 2 Max is FDM (filament) and the Phrozen Sonic Mini 8K S is RESIN (resin). FDM prints bigger functional parts; resin delivers finer surface detail.
